Diagnosis. Adult ( Figs 1B View FIGURE 1 , 3B View FIGURE 3 , 11F View FIGURE 11 ). Wingspan 8.0–12.0 mm. This species is superficially very similar to T. latistriata , T. contracta and T. projecta . Since those species display intraspecific variations in the wing pattern and color, it might be difficult to separate them based solely on such external characteristics. However, T. pancratiastis usually have the forewing marked with three white streaks in basal 1/3 between costa and fold whereas there are only one or two streaks in other three species. Another good diagnostic character separating those species is to compare the scape of antennae: T. pancratiastis has alternating black and white streaks dorsally whereas the scape is creamy white except the posterior margin fuscous or black in other three species. The coloration of female labial palpi is also slightly different in those species: the outer surface of segment II is fuscous to black in basal half in T. pancratiastis , but it is fuscous in basal 2/3 or 3/ 4 in other species. The male sternum VIII ( Fig. 25D View FIGURE 25 ) of T. pancratiastis is distinctive as it is pentagon-shaped whereas those of related species are subtriangular. The male genitalia ( Fig. 36B View FIGURE 36 ) can easily be distinguished from its allies by the larger anellus lobe with a robust apical bristle and the aedeagus with a well-developed coiled lamina. The female genitalia ( Fig. 52F View FIGURE 52 ) can be differentiated from T. latistriata and T. contracta by the smooth segment VIII without minute spines and the large cup-shaped antrum.

Variations. The specimens from Yunnan tend to be darker than those from other regions. The species shows minor variations in forewing color and patterns, especially in the length and width of streaks.

Biology. The larva is a leaf feeder ( Moriuti 1982) or a seed predator ( Fujita et al. 2009) on the host plant. In Japan, the adult occurs twice a year and overwinters as a larva ( Moriuti 1982).

Host plant. Myricaceae : Myrica rubra (Lour.) Siebold & Zucc. ( Moriuti 1982; Fujita et al. 2009; Sakamaki 2013).

Distribution. China (Chongqing, Fujian, Guangdong, Guangxi, Guizhou, Hubei, Jiangxi, Taiwan, Yunnan, Zhejiang), Cambodia (new record), Japan, Korea, India.
